Fumes inside the car reminds me of the E53 X5 i had that had the same issue. Turned out to be a leaking exhaust manifold (the stainless steel manifold is prone to cracking- it has a double skin so it is difficult to repair). Not sure if the twin turbo has the same issue? But worth a look.
